Board Meetings

The Arapahoe/Douglas Workforce Board meets on the first Thursday, bi-monthly starting in February, from 11:00am – 1:00pm.

Members Wanted

The Arapahoe/Douglas Workforce Development Board is seeking task force members!

As an Arapahoe/Douglas Workforce Development task force member, you will work collaboratively
and cooperatively with other stakeholders to guide strategies and support the local workforce system in
expanding knowledge, services, resources, and/or program outcomes.
